What is the relationship between Free Sora Generator and OpenAI's Sora?

Free Sora Generator is an independent service provider and is not affiliated with OpenAI. We provide a specialized application layer and interface built around the advanced Sora 2 model framework. Our platform adds significant value through a dedicated web application, a developer-friendly API, performance optimizations, and a streamlined credit system that abstracts away infrastructure complexity for end-users.

How can developers integrate the video generation capability?

Integration is primarily facilitated through our well-documented REST API. Developers can authenticate using API keys, submit generation jobs with text or image prompts, and retrieve completed videos. The API supports asynchronous processing with webhook notifications, making it compatible with serverless functions, backend applications, and automated workflows. Full SDKs and code examples are provided to accelerate integration.

What are the technical specifications of the generated videos?

The platform generates high-quality, watermark-free video files suitable for professional use. While exact resolutions can vary based on the prompt and model parameters, outputs are optimized for web and social media platforms, typically in standard formats like MP4 with H.264 encoding. The system is engineered for temporal coherence and realistic physics, as defined by the underlying Sora 2 model capabilities.

What does the credit system entail and how do I get started?

The platform uses a credit-based system to manage computational resources. Each video generation consumes a certain number of credits, which vary based on video length and complexity. All new accounts receive free trial credits to test the service. Following the trial, users can purchase credit packs that suit their volume needs. This model provides clear, predictable pricing for both occasional users and high-volume enterprise integrations.

What input methods does Kling 5.0 support?

Kling 5.0 is a multimodal AI video generator. It accepts three primary input types: text prompts (text-to-video), uploaded images or concept art (image-to-video), and audio for driving lip-sync and scene generation. This flexibility allows users to start the creative process from whichever medium best suits their existing assets or workflow.

How does the character consistency feature work?

Character consistency is managed through the Omni Subject Library. When you generate or define a character, the system creates a unique digital fingerprint of that subject. You can then reference this fingerprint in subsequent prompts for different shots or scenes. Kling 5.0's AI engine uses this reference to maintain the locked facial features, proportions, and style, ensuring visual continuity across your project.

In which languages does the lip-sync feature work?

The native audio generation and phoneme-level lip-sync technology in Kling 5.0 currently supports five languages: English, Chinese, Japanese, Korean, and Spanish. The AI models the specific mouth shapes and movements for each language to produce highly accurate and natural-looking synchronization between the generated speech and the character's lips.

What is the maximum video length and output resolution?

Kling 5.0 can generate video clips with a maximum duration of 15 seconds per generation cycle. The output is rendered in professional 4K resolution (3840 x 2160 pixels), ensuring high detail and clarity suitable for most digital platforms and even broadcast use cases without quality degradation.
